- [ ] **Step 7: Breaker override escrow.** After sealing the signing keys for the Tallgrove upstream API circuit breaker, confirm the support team can force the breaker open during a full outage. The override bundle lives in the sealed escrow drawer and is useless without its unlock phrase. Two ceremony witnesses must initial this step before proceeding. The escrow bundle is decrypted with the recovery passphrase that follows.

vault phrase of kahip-kahop = holath-quenmir

Minutes – Management Meeting, Velmora Appliances

Warranty costs on the Brayton oven line ran 18% over budget this quarter, driven by heating-element failures from the Kestwick plant. Ms. Darnell will negotiate revised supplier terms; branch managers should log all claims weekly. A revised reserve figure follows in October. The related planning note is set out below.

management briefing: The steering committee signed off on a budget of $36.7 million for Project Kasvan.

Bounceworks plugin authors: if your processor account locks after repeated webhook auth failures, stop retries immediately. Locked accounts quarantine your bounce queue for 24h. Recovery: open the partner console, select your plugin, choose account recovery, confirm the plugin slug, and wait for queue replay. The console's recovery prompt accepts the passphrase below.

vault phrase of bagaf-kajeg = jorath-feniel-briir-siliel-ralix

Q: How does Lanternkeep guard the bloom filter fronting the Oxbarrow key-value store?

A: The filter is rebuilt hourly from the store's manifest; false positives are bounded at 0.4%. Rebuild jobs run under a sealed credential. If the rebuild credential is revoked during an incident, recovery requires the passphrase recorded below.

vault phrase of bafop-kahop = sormir-frador